Coleman 'deeply disappointed' in U.S. attorney resignations
Source: Associated Press

Apr 10, 2007 6:15 PM (5 hrs ago)
By FREDERIC J. FROMMER, AP

WASHINGTON (Map, News) - Sen. Norm Coleman, who championed Rachel Paulose's nomination as U.S. attorney for Minnesota last year, told her he was "deeply disappointed" to learn of the self-demotions of three of the top prosecutors in her office.

Coleman, R-Minn., made the comment in a letter to Paulose on Tuesday, in which he cited media reports that the resignations were made because of concerns about her management style and abilities. ~snip~

Also Tuesday, the state's other senator, Democrat Amy Klobuchar, urged the Justice Department to inform Congress if it uncovers any evidence that political pressure was a factor in the resignations.

Klobuchar made the request in a letter to Steve Parent, the acting director of the Justice Department's Executive Office for United States Attorneys. She cited the "serious credibility issues" the Justice Department faces regarding the firing of eight U.S. attorneys last year. ~snip~
